HUMBOLDT PARK — A 61-year-old man has been charged in the fatal stabbing of a Humboldt Park man.

Police said Daniel Travis stabbed 47-year-old Gregory Shanks Wednesday afternoon during an argument in a building in the 700 block of North Trumbull Avenue.

About 3 p.m., police found Shanks lying on the floor of the building vestibule with stab wounds in his chest and head.

Travis, who lives on the block, was also inside the building and "openly admitted to stabbing" Shanks when a verbal argument escalated, police said.

Shanks, of the 600 block of North Homan Avenue, was taken to Mount Sinai Hospital, where he was pronounced dead at 3:45 p.m., according to the Cook County Medical Examiner's Office.

Travis is expected to appear in bond court Friday, police said.
